A review on phase change energy storage: materials and applications

Materials to be used for phase change thermal energy storage must have a large latent heat and high thermal conductivity. They should have a melting temperature lying in the practical range of operation, melt congruently with minimum subcooling and be chemically stable, low in cost, non-toxic and non-corrosive.

What is a box-type phase change energy storage?

Box-type phase change energy storage thermal reservoir phase change materials have high energy storage density; the amount of heat stored in the same volume can be 5–15 times that of water, and the volume can also be 3–10 times smaller than that of ordinary water in the same thermal energy storage case .
